Flower Artist Makoto Azuma Reveals His "Hand" in "Flower Method"
Makoto Azuma, a flower artist whose innovative creations have garnered significant attention, has released his book "Flower Method" through Bijutsu Shuppan-sha, which comprehensively introduces his techniques.
Text by YANAKA Tomomi
Photography by Shunsuke Shiiki, who co-founded "Jardin des Fleurs" with Azuma
Makoto Azuma opened "Jardin des Fleurs," an haute couture flower shop, in 2001, quickly gaining popularity for his creative arrangements. He is a flower artist whose work is showcased in museums and galleries both domestically and internationally. In recent years, his activities have expanded to collaborations with luxury brands and exhibitions abroad, drawing attention across a wide spectrum.
"Flower Method," born as a technique book, reveals the "hand" of Azuma, who has a large following worldwide. It introduces various techniques. The basic section analyzes flowers from four aspects—form, color, texture, and scent—to maximize their appeal. It explains the principles of creation through detailed instructions for 12 arrangements.
The advanced section, through instructions for 17 works, lectures on creating arrangements for diverse styles and occasions. It also unveils the "leaf work" technique, using foliage, which is employed in Azuma's signature "botanical sculptures."
The photographs of his unique creations were taken by Shunsuke Shiiki, who established "Jardin des Fleurs" with Azuma. As a partner who has worked together for many years, Shiiki's photography perfectly accentuates the individuality of Azuma's work.
In the preface, Azuma states, "I believe that 'reconstructing a new 'nature'' and 'maximizing the appeal of living flowers' are more important than technique when engaging with this book." "Flower Method," which presents not only techniques but also Azuma's approach to flowers and nature, along with his arrangements, is sure to enrich the hearts of many, not just those involved in flower arranging.
